2025 Mercedes C-Class New Model First Look

Recently, spy photographers captured the first prototypes of the facelifted version of the German sedan, giving us an initial glimpse of what the car might look like. The C-Class model traces its history back to 1993, when the first generation with the W202 designation debuted, replacing the 190 (W201) compact sedan in the German brand’s lineup. Since then, the car has undergone several generational changes, with the fifth generation currently in production, having premiered in February 2021. Now, the time has come for a planned facelift, and just recently, the first photos of camouflaged test prototypes of the upcoming model appeared online.

Mercedes C-Class – New Model, first look!

 
After 4 years, Mercedes will operate a facelift to the Mercedes C-Class (W206), which will be unveiled in the spring of 2025 and will be available from the summer of 2025.
 
Launched in March 2021, the fifth-generation Mercedes C-Class (W206) has been on the market for 4 years, so it’s about time for a facelift. The first spy photos are already circulating on the internet, and the YouTube channel #carbizzy has made some computer-retouched images based on the pictures of the masked car.
 
The main change is that the new Mercedes C-Class will take the front end with the radiator grille and headlights from the Mercedes E-Class, while the daytime running lights with the Mercedes logo are inspired by the Mercedes CLA Concept. The Mercedes logo will also be found on the new C-Class’s taillights. The exterior mirrors have been redesigned with slim LED lights and cameras for the 360-degree camera system.
 
So far, there is little information about the interior but it seems that the facelifted Mercedes C-Class will get better materials and the MBUX multimedia system will be upgraded. Although there are rumors of changing the center display, which is similar to the S-Class, we don’t think Mercedes will go for something else as it wants to maintain the differentiation from the E-Class with its Superscreen display.
 
The current-generation C-Class has no fewer than 17 versions. All diesel and gasoline engines feature 48V mild hybrid and no less than three plug-in hybrid versions are available including a diesel PHEV (C 300e/C 300 e 4Matic, C 300 de/ C 300 de 4Matic, C 400 e 4Matic), available with rear- or all-wheel drive. The plug-in hybrid versions have large batteries that give them electric ranges of 100 km or more. That’s why we think the PHEV versions will remain on offer in the same form.
 

Instead, Mercedes is working on a new generation of modular engines with Geely, with the first powertrains already announced for the new CLA. The new 1.5-liter four-cylinder engines develop 120, 163, or 190 PS and will likely replace the current 1.5-liter engines in the C 180 and C 200.
 
Mercedes and Geely are also working on a 2.0-liter version of the new engines that could debut in the facelifted C-Class, replacing the 2.0-liter engine in the C 300.
 
Things are more complicated at the top end of the range, where customers are unhappy with the top-of-the-range AMG C 63 S E Performance model which has an engine with just four cylinders. There are rumors that the 4-cylinder engine will be replaced by a V8 or inline-6, both with 48V mild-hybrid.
 
The Mercedes-AMG CLE 53 4Matic coupe that is built on the same platform as the C-Class features the 449 PS, 3.0-liter inline 6-cylinder engine mated to a 48V mild hybrid system, while the upcoming AMG CLE 63 4Matic+ will have a V8 engine with a mild hybrid system.
 
For the first time, the Mercedes C-Class will also be available as an electric model. The body will be similar to the conventional model but under the body will be hidden the dedicated MB.EA electric platform. The electric C-Class will debut in 2026. Until then, Mercedes will present the facelifted C-Class with conventional engines in the spring of 2025, which will be available in showrooms in the summer of 2025.
